What are characteristics of the use of transactions in Snowflake? (Choose two.)

  • A. Explicit transactions can contain DDL, DML, and query statements.
  • B. The AUTOCOMMIT setting can be changed inside a stored procedure.
  • C. A transaction can be started explicitly by executing a BEGIN WORK statement and end explicitly by executing a COMMIT WORK statement.
  • D. A transaction can be started explicitly by executing a BEGIN TRANSACTION statement and end explicitly by executing an END TRANSACTION statement.
  • E. Explicit transactions should contain only DML statements and query statements. All DDL statements implicitly commit active transactions.
Show Suggested Answer Hide Answer
Suggested Answer: CE 🗳️
